- The Indian President recently conferred the Tagore Award for Cultural Harmony. The awardees were Rajkumar Singhajit Singh (2014), Chhayanaut (2015) and Ram Vanji Sutar (2016).
- Rajkumar Singhajit Singh is a leading exponent, choreographer of Manipuri dance- one of the major Indian classical dance form.
- Chhayanaut is a Bangladeshi cultural organisation. It has played a significant role in promoting and preserving Rabindranath Tagore’s works and philosophy in Bangladesh
- Ram Vanji Suthar is a famous Indian sculptor. He has designed the Statue of Unity. The statue of unity is the world’s tallest statue of iconic Indian leader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el located near Sardar Sarovar Dam in Gujarat.
